Pikzie লিখুন এবং পাইথন জন্য ডিবাগ ইউনিট টেস্টিং কাঠামো করার জন্য একটি সহজ.
Pikzie মান পাইথন ডিস্ট্রিবিউশনের মধ্যে অন্তর্ভুক্ত unittest.py ইঙ্গিতও করা হয় যে নিম্নলিখিত বৈশিষ্ট্য উপলব্ধ করা হয়:
* পাইথনীয় API- টি
* গবেষকেরা অনেক
* আউটপুট ডিবাগ জন্য দরকারী বিন্যাস সঙ্গে স্থাপিত.
ইনস্টল করুন:
% উবুন্টু পাইথন ইনস্টল setup.py
ব্যবহার:
আমরা আপনাকে নিম্নলিখিত ডিরেক্টরির কাঠামো আছে অনুমান:
. - + + - Lib --- your_module --- ...
& Nbsp; |
& Nbsp; - পরীক্ষা - + + - run-test.py
& Nbsp; |
& Nbsp; - __init__.py
& Nbsp; |
& Nbsp; - test_module1.py
& Nbsp; |
& Nbsp; - ...
পরীক্ষা / run-test.py হল:
#! / Usr / bin / env ময়াল সাপ
আমদানি sys
আমদানি অপারেটিং সিস্টেম
base_dir = os.path.abspath (os.path.join (os.path.dirname (__ file__), ".."))
sys.path.insert (0, os.path.join (base_dir, "lib"))
sys.path.insert (0, base_dir)
আমদানি pikzie
sys.exit (pikzie.Tester (). চালানোর ())
. পরীক্ষা / পরীক্ষা: _ * PY স্বয়ংক্রিয়ভাবে লোড করা হয় এবং নির্ধারিত পরীক্ষা নিম্নলিখিত মত run-test.py invoking দ্বারা স্থাপিত হয়:
% পরীক্ষা / run-test.py
এই রিলিজে নতুন কি:
- ভুল সনাক্তকরণ 'সাজানো' ফিক্স Li>
- assert_search_syslog_call বার্তা সনাক্তকরণ উন্নতি
আবশ্যক
- পাইথন
পাওয়া মন্তব্যসমূহ না